Each time a new house is built from this blueprint, we …Aug 6, 2018 · There’s no way for Python to tell that you wanted one of them to be a local function and the other one to be a method. They’re both defined exactly the same way. And really, they’re both. In Python, anything you put in a class statement body is local while that class definition is happening, and it becomes a class attribute later. Kn... 3.14159 3.14159 Code language: Python (python) How Python class attributes work. When you access an attribute via an instance of the class, Python searches for the attribute in the instance attribute list. If the instance attribute list doesn’t have that attribute, Python continues looking up the attribute in the class attribute list.
